<div class='os_post_top_link'><a href='http://www.pocketgamer.org/video/' target='_blank'>http://www.pocketgamer.org/video/</a><br /><br /></div>Have you ever debated about downloading a game for your Pocket PC, realized the screenshots weren't enough, but didn't have the time or desire to go through the trial process? David over from PocketGamer wrote in to let us know they now have a "video clips" section where you can watch extended previews of games to get a better feel than just screenshots.<br /><br />Currently, there are 4 videos, but they hope to steadily increase the library in the near future. David also commented that he'd "really appreciate it if you could send a few visitors our way to hammer the server - I need to find out whether it's capable of sustained streaming for a start!"... so take a look. ;)
